I have a hen I treated for bumble foot a few weeks ago. Today I was giving her feet a look over when she peed on me.. except I thought chickens didn't pee?
I was holding her with her back to my chest with one hand so I could un curl and inspect her left foot with my other. She was fighting me a little (not flapping around or anything) when a clear, water like, liquid gushed out her bottom onto my sandal. She has no symptoms of being sick. I'm just wondering what that was? I'm hoping it wasn't an egg rupture. But it wasn't the consistency of egg. Should I be concerned? Thank you for reading this.
